Paris – French television audiences tuned in​ to a familiar mix of game shows, news, and dramas on ⁢Wednesday, May 7, 2025, with France⁢ 2’s “Don’t‌ Forget the Lyrics!” leading the pack during the⁤ crucial 5 p.m.to 8 p.m.⁢ time slot. Other programs⁣ drawing significant viewership ⁣included “The Wheel of Fortune,” “C⁤ to you,” and “Here It All Starts.”

Key Audience Figures

Data‍ provided by Médiamétrie indicates the following viewership numbers for​ select programs:

France 2

  • “Don’t Forget the Lyrics!” (7:15 p.m.): 2.5 million viewers (17.8% share)
  • “Don’t Forget the Lyrics!” (6:40 p.m.): 1.79‌ million viewers‌ (15.8% share)
  • “Everyone Has‍ a Say” (6:00 p.m.): 1.13 million viewers ⁣(12.7% share)

France 3

  • “Questions for a Champion” (1:00 p.m.): ⁣1.07 million viewers (11.6% share)
  • “Slam” (5:30 p.m.): 889,000 viewers (13.5% share)
  • “Family Duels” (2:45 p.m.): 510,000 viewers (9.4% share)

M6

  • “The Wheel of Fortune” (5:30 p.m.): 737,000 ⁢viewers (9.8% share)

Analysis of Performance

While “Don’t Forget the ⁣Lyrics!” maintained its lead on France 2, the first segment⁣ of the⁢ show experienced a slight ‌dip of 0.6 percentage points.The second part saw a decrease of ‍390,000 viewers⁢ compared to the ⁢previous day.

Olivier minne and Sidonie Bonnec, after achieving thier best ratings in a month and a half, saw a decrease ‍of 280,000 viewers.

On France 3, “Questions ​for a ​Champion” surpassed the one ‍million viewer mark, gaining 1.3 ‍percentage points from the previous day. “Slam,” featuring ‌Théo Curin, increased its audience ⁤by 130,000 viewers, nearing 900,000.

M6’s “The Wheel of Fortune,” hosted by Eric​ Antoine, lost 140,000 viewers.

Q: What ⁣is a “share” of viewership?

A: The “share” of viewership indicates the percentage of viewers watching a specific program‍ during⁢ a given time slot, compared to the total number of⁤ people watching television at that time.Such as, a 17.8% share ⁣means that 17.8% of all⁢ TV viewers ⁤were‍ tuned into “Don’t Forget the lyrics!” at 7:15 p.m.
